6Val d’Orcia, Tuscany
While Tuscany is world-famous, the Val d’Orcia region remains a favorite for Italians seeking peaceful countryside retreats.
Rolling hills, cypress-lined roads, and charming villages like Pienza, Montalcino, and Bagno Vignoni create a timeless atmosphere. Locals often rent small apartments or agriturismi at reasonable prices, enjoying local wine and cuisine in tranquility, away from Florence and Siena’s tourist throngs.
